Colorado's Dominance

The Avalanche have been the team to beat all season long. With an impressive record and a Presidents' Trophy under their belt, they've established themselves as the NHL's strongest team on paper. Their offensive firepower, led by Nathan MacKinnon's 53 goals and a stellar plus-minus rating, is simply unmatched. But it's not just the offense; their goaltending, anchored by Scott Wedgewood, has been nothing short of spectacular. However, as they say, the road to the Stanley Cup is never easy. If the Avs advance, they'll face a daunting challenge in either the Dallas Stars or Minnesota Wild, both formidable opponents.

Buffalo Sabres' Cup Quest

The Buffalo Sabres have broken free from their 14-year playoff drought and are now aiming for their first-ever Stanley Cup. It hasn't been an easy journey, with early season struggles and a stretch of losses. But the Sabres dug deep, finding their rhythm with a remarkable winning streak. Their depth is a key strength, with 13 players contributing double-digit goals. Tage Thompson has been a standout, leading the team in both goals and assists. Oilers' Redemption Arc

The Edmonton Oilers have experienced heartbreak in the past two Stanley Cup Finals, falling to the Florida Panthers. Despite a slight regression this season, they've managed to secure the second spot in the Pacific Division. The Oilers have been led by the NHL's best player, Connor McDavid, who has put up incredible numbers. However, their defensive struggles have been a concern, with a league-low save percentage. The return of Leon Draisaitl, who has been out with an injury, could be a game-changer. Penguins' Return to Glory

The Pittsburgh Penguins, led by the legendary duo of Sidney Crosby and Evgeni Malkin, are back in the playoffs after a three-year absence. Under first-year head coach Dan Muse, they've secured the second spot in the Metropolitan Division. Crosby, at 38, continues to lead the team with his 74 points, while Malkin, at 39, has contributed significantly. The Penguins' strength lies in their offense, but their defensive woes have been a cause for concern. Vegas Golden Knights' Resurgence

The Vegas Golden Knights have undergone a remarkable transformation since making a coaching change. Under John Tortorella, they've gone on a seven-game winning streak, securing the Pacific Division title. Goaltender Carter Hart, returning from injury, has been a key factor in their success. Jack Eichel has also been on a tear, leading the team in points. With a deep and talented roster, the Golden Knights are a scary prospect for any Western Conference team.
